BLOG LIST
Blog List
Modifica dei Permalink in WordPress 3.9.2
Avere una buona impostazione dei permalink del proprio sito è fondamentale ai fini di migliorare indicizzazione e posizionamento sui motori di ricerca.
Per modificare i permalink del proprio di sito su WordPress:
- Andare su Settings -> Permalink
- Selezionare la tipologia di link che si vuole utilizzare sul proprio sito
(è consigliabile la forma www.miostio.it/postname/) - Cliccare su Save Changes
E’ possibile che a procedura terminata venga visualizzato il messaggio di errore “You should update your web.config now.”
In pratica il Web Server non permette la modifica del file web.config (su un server Windows) o .htacess (Su un sever Linux)
A questo punto è necessario aggiungere le modifiche necessarie al funzionamento dei nuovi permalink manualmente:
- Accedere al file web.config nella home directory del sito (Se non esiste creare un file vuoto di nome web.config)
- Se il file non è vuoto aggiungere la seguente regola (tra i tag rules) che permetta il giusto indirizzamento alle pagine con i nuovi permalink
[xml]<rule name=”Main Rule” stopProcessing=”true”>
<match url=”.*” />
<conditions logicalGrouping=”MatchAll”>
<add input=”{REQUEST_FILENAME}” matchType=”IsFile” negate=”true” />
<add input=”{REQUEST_FILENAME}” matchType=”IsDirectory” negate=”true” />
</conditions>
<action type=”Rewrite” url=”index.php” />
</rule>[/xml] - Se il file è vuoto aggiungere tutto il codice seguente
[xml]<?xml version=”1.0″ encoding=”UTF-8″?>
<configuration>
<system.webServer>
<rewrite>
<rules>
<rule name=”Main Rule” stopProcessing=”true”>
<match url=”.*” />
<conditions logicalGrouping=”MatchAll”>
<add input=”{REQUEST_FILENAME}” matchType=”IsFile” negate=”true” />
<add input=”{REQUEST_FILENAME}” matchType=”IsDirectory” negate=”true” />
</conditions>
<action type=”Rewrite” url=”index.php” />
</rule>
</rules>
</rewrite>
</system.webServer>
</configuration>[/xml] - Salvare il file.
Ora, accedendo al sito, i link avranno la struttura desiderata.